Best Tecumseh Public Charter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public charter schools serving 49 students in Tecumseh, OK.
Tecumseh, OK public charter schools have a diversity score of 0.60, which is less than the Oklahoma public charter school average of 0.73.
Minority enrollment is 82%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Oklahoma public charter school average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
